A felt fabric with permittivity 1.2 and thickness 0.7¿mm is used as a substrate. The proposed design is validated by comparison of 3D electromagnetic simulations and measurements. The obtained results correspond to S11 < -18¿dB and a gain 1.5¿dB at resonance frequency, with 49% efficiency and a 20¿MHz bandwidth. Moreover, the effect of bending of the e-textiles under realistic scenarios is also studied.
